Introduction to AR technology: Understanding the basics and principles of Augmented Reality (AR) technology and its applications in exhibitions.
Current AR trends in exhibitions: Exploring the current state of AR technology in exhibitions, including case studies and best practices.
Designing AR experiences for exhibitions: Learning the key principles of designing immersive and engaging AR experiences for exhibition attendees.
Implementing AR in exhibitions: Understanding the technical and logistical considerations of implementing AR technology in exhibitions, including hardware, software, and network requirements.
Evaluating AR effectiveness in exhibitions: Learning how to measure the impact and effectiveness of AR technology in exhibitions, including metrics and analytics.
Future of AR in exhibitions: Exploring the potential future developments and applications of AR technology in the exhibition industry.
Ethical considerations of AR in exhibitions: Understanding the ethical implications of using AR technology in exhibitions, including privacy, accessibility, and cultural sensitivity.
Collaboration and partnerships in AR exhibitions: Learning how to build successful partnerships and collaborations with AR technology providers, developers, and other stakeholders in the exhibition industry.

AR/VR Developer: 35% AR/VR Developers are primarily responsible for creating immersive experiences and applications for AR and VR platforms. They need to be proficient in programming languages like C#, C++, and Java, as well as game engines such as Unity and Unreal Engine. 2. 3D Artist: 25% 3D Artists specialize in creating 3D models, environments, and animations for AR and VR applications. They should be well-versed in 3D modeling tools like Blender, Maya, or 3DS Max, and have a keen eye for detail and design. 3. UX Designer (AR/VR): 20% UX Designers for AR and VR focus on creating user-friendly interfaces and interactions for immersive experiences. They need to understand human-computer interaction principles and leverage design tools like Sketch, Figma, or Adobe XD. 4. Data Visualization Designer: 10% Data Visualization Designers are tasked with presenting complex data sets in an accessible and visually appealing manner. They should be skilled in data analysis, statistics, and design software like Tableau, Power BI, or D3.js. 5. AR Hardware Engineer: 10% AR Hardware Engineers work on developing and improving AR devices, such as smart glasses and headsets. They need a solid understanding of electronics, optics, and software development to create reliable and high-performing hardware.
